II.1.1) Title
Provision of Designated Person for the Ports & Marine Facilities Safety Code and Marine Safety Management System (MSMS)
Reference number: OIC/PROC/2414
II.1.2) Main CPV code
98360000
II.1.3) Type of contract
Services
II.1.4) Short description
Orkney Islands Council is the Statutory and Competent Harbour Authority for the Local Authority ports of Scapa Flow, Kirkwall and additional ferry terminals / piers within the Orkney Islands group. Orkney Islands Council has a requirement for a practical, pragmatic and independent person / company to be the Designated Person, as specified within the Ports & Marine Facilities Safety Code published by Department of Transport in April 2025 and detailed in A Guide to Good Practice on Port and Marine Facilities – Prepared in Conjunction with the Ports & Marine Facilities Safety Code published in April 2025, and any further updated / amendments for the period of this contracts.

III.1.1) Suitability to pursue the professional activity, including requirements relating to enrolment on professional or trade registers
List and brief description of conditions:
Managerial Staff would have a minimum qualification of SCTW / RN Officer of the Watch Certificate or equivalent.
Senior Managers would be expected to have a higher qualification and / or Harbour Master / Port Management qualifications.
